微机原理及控制技术实验教程_第1页
微机原理及控制技术实验教程_第2页
微机原理及控制技术实验教程_第3页
微机原理及控制技术实验教程_第4页
微机原理及控制技术实验教程_第5页
已阅读5页,还剩2页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

《微机原理及控制技术实验教程》简介内容概述《微机原理及控制技术实验教程》是一本旨在帮助读者理解和掌握微机原理及控制技术的实验指导书。本书详细介绍了微机系统的基本结构、工作原理以及如何利用微机进行控制技术相关的实验。全书内容丰富,覆盖了从微处理器的基础知识到高级控制系统的设计与实现,适合电子工程、自动化、计算机科学与技术等相关专业的本科生和研究生阅读和学习。实验内容1.微处理器基础本书首先介绍了微处理器的基本概念,包括微处理器的架构、指令集、数据表示等。通过一系列实验,读者可以掌握如何使用汇编语言编写程序,以及如何使用调试工具来分析和解决程序中的问题。2.输入/输出接口在理解了微处理器的内部工作原理后,读者将学习如何通过输入/输出接口与外部世界进行交互。本书提供了多种接口技术的实验,如并行接口、串行接口、定时器/计数器等,帮助读者理解如何设计有效的输入/输出系统。3.存储器系统内存和外存是微机系统中的重要组成部分。本书通过实验指导读者如何使用不同的存储技术,包括SRAM、DRAM、ROM、EPROM、Flash等,以及如何进行存储器的扩展和优化。4.总线与通信总线是微机系统中各个部件之间数据传输的公共通道。本书介绍了不同类型的总线,如ISA、PCI、USB等,并通过实验让读者掌握如何使用总线进行数据传输和设备通信。5.控制技术基础控制技术是微机原理及控制技术实验教程的核心内容之一。本书提供了关于反馈控制、PID控制、状态空间分析等基础理论的实验,帮助读者理解如何利用微机实现各种控制策略。6.高级控制技术随着技术的发展,微机控制技术不断进步。本书介绍了高级控制技术,如模糊控制、神经网络控制、遗传算法等,并通过实验让读者体验这些技术的实际应用。7.系统设计与实现最后,本书指导读者如何将所学知识应用到实际系统中。通过系统设计、硬件选型、软件编程、测试与调试等实验,读者可以锻炼综合运用知识的能力。适用性《微机原理及控制技术实验教程》不仅适用于电子工程、自动化、计算机科学与技术等专业的教学和科研,也适用于希望深入了解微机原理及控制技术的工程师和技术人员。本书的实验内容丰富,操作性强,可以帮助读者将理论知识转化为实际操作能力。总结《微机原理及控制技术实验教程》是一本内容专业、丰富,适用性强的实验指导书。通过本书的学习,读者可以深入理解微机系统的内部工作原理,掌握控制技术的基础知识和高级应用,并能够独立设计和实现复杂的控制系统。无论是作为教学用书还是自学参考,本书都是一本不可或缺的指南。#微机原理及控制技术实验教程引言在现代电子信息技术领域,微机原理及控制技术扮演着至关重要的角色。微机,即微型计算机,是现代计算和控制系统的核心。它不仅在个人计算领域中广泛应用,更是众多自动化系统和嵌入式系统中的关键组成部分。本实验教程旨在为初学者提供一个系统学习微机原理及控制技术的平台,通过理论与实践相结合的方式,帮助读者掌握微机的工作原理、硬件结构、编程控制以及应用开发等方面的知识。第一部分:微机原理基础1.1微机概述微机由哪些主要部件组成?它们分别是:-中央处理器(CPU)-随机存取存储器(RAM)-只读存储器(ROM)-输入/输出设备(I/O)-总线1.2中央处理器(CPU)CPU是微机的核心部件,负责执行指令和处理数据。它通常包括两个主要部分:-控制器:负责解释指令和控制计算机各部分的工作。-运算器:负责执行算术和逻辑运算。1.3存储器系统存储器系统分为两大类:-随机存取存储器(RAM):用于存储当前正在运行的程序和数据,断电后信息会丢失。-只读存储器(ROM):用于存储永久性的程序和数据,断电后信息不会丢失。1.4输入/输出设备(I/O)I/O设备是微机与外部世界交互的桥梁,包括键盘、鼠标、显示器、打印机等。1.5总线总线是一种内部结构,用于在CPU、内存和输入/输出设备之间传输数据。第二部分:微机控制技术2.1微机控制系统的组成一个典型的微机控制系统包括:-控制器-被控对象-传感器-执行器2.2控制原理控制原理涉及反馈、开环控制、闭环控制等概念。2.3编程控制编程控制是微机控制技术的核心,包括高级语言编程和汇编语言编程。2.4应用实例通过实际案例分析,如温度控制系统、工业机器人等,加深对微机控制技术的理解。第三部分:实验操作与指导3.1实验环境准备准备实验所需的硬件和软件环境,包括微机开发板、编译器等。3.2基本实验操作介绍如何进行基本的实验操作,如程序编写、编译、下载和调试。3.3实验项目设计设计一系列实验项目,如交通灯控制、流水灯控制等,指导读者完成实验。3.4实验数据记录与分析如何记录实验数据,并进行分析以优化控制效果。第四部分:综合应用与创新4.1综合应用案例分析复杂的微机控制应用案例,如智能家居系统、汽车电子控制等。4.2创新设计与实现鼓励读者进行创新设计,并提供实现思路和方法。结论微机原理及控制技术是现代电子信息领域不可或缺的一部分。通过本实验教程的学习,读者应该能够掌握微机的基本工作原理、控制技术以及如何通过实验操作来验证和应用这些知识。希望读者能够以此为基础,进一步探索微机控制技术的奥秘,并将其应用于实际问题解决和创新设计中。#微机原理及控制技术实验教程概述微机原理及控制技术是一门涵盖了计算机硬件基础、微处理器工作原理、汇编语言编程以及计算机控制技术等多方面知识的课程。本实验教程旨在通过实验操作,帮助学生更好地理解和掌握这些知识,并将其应用于实际问题解决中。实验环境与工具硬件环境本实验教程推荐使用基于x86架构的个人计算机进行实验。学生应熟悉计算机的基本组成,包括CPU、主板、内存、硬盘、显卡等部件。软件环境实验中将使用到多种软件工具,如汇编语言编译器、调试器、操作系统等。学生应具备基本的Windows操作系统使用技能,并能熟练使用命令行工具。实验内容与要求实验一:8086微处理器基础实验目的了解8086微处理器的内部结构。掌握8086的汇编语言编程基础。实验内容编写简单的汇编语言程序,如“Hello,World!”。学习使用调试器进行程序调试。实验二:内存与存储管理实验目的理解内存的物理和逻辑结构。掌握程序的加载和存储管理技术。实验内容学习如何使用不同的寻址方式来访问内存。编写程序以管理内存的分配和释放。实验三:输入/输出控制实验目的学习如何通过程序控制外部设备。掌握输入/输出指令的使用。实验内容编写程序控制键盘和鼠标的输入。实现简单的串口通信程序。实验四:中断与定时器实验目的理解中断的概念和处理流程。掌握定时器的使用方法。实验内容编写程序处理不同类型的中断。使用定时器实现延时和频率计数功能。实验五:汇编语言高级编程实验目的学习汇编语言的高级编程技巧。掌握宏、函数、数据结构等高级概念。实验内容编写复杂的汇编语言程序,使用宏和函数。实现简单的堆栈和队列等数据结构。实验六:计算机控制系统设计实验目的学习如何使用计算机控制实际系统。掌握控制系统设计的基本方法。实验内容设计一个简单的温度控制系统。使用模拟和数字输入/输出设备进行控制。实验报告与评估实验报告实验报告应包括实验目的、实验步骤、实验结果和分析。学生应详细记录实验过程中的问题和解决方法。评估方法实验成绩将根据实验报告的质量和实验操作的熟练程度综合评估。鼓励学生创新,对于

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论